What is a senior data analyst?

Senior Data Analysts are experienced professionals who collect, process, and analyze complex data sets to help organizations make data-driven decisions. They often lead analytics projects, design data models, and communicate findings to stakeholders using reports and visualizations. In addition to technical expertise with tools like SQL, Python, or R, they frequently mentor junior analysts and work closely with business leaders to identify opportunities for improvement. Their insights can drive strategy, optimize operations, and support organizational goals.

What does a senior data analyst do?

A senior data analyst develops and leads a team of data analysts in business or research projects. Job duties include consulting with other departments and management, conducting research using analytical tools, developing business solutions, and writing reports. Qualifications for a career as a senior data analyst include a bachelor’s degree in statistics, computer science, or a related field; job experience in data analytics; familiarity with data modeling languages such as R and Python; and leadership skills.

The main difference between a Senior Data Analyst and a Data Scientist lies in their focus and skill set. Senior Data Analysts primarily handle data analysis, reporting, and visualization, while Data Scientists work on predictive modeling, machine learning, and advanced algorithms. Both roles require strong analytical skills, but Data Scientists typically have more technical expertise in programming and statistical modeling.

What are some common challenges senior data analysts face when collaborating with cross-functional teams?

Senior Data Analysts often work closely with departments such as product, marketing, and engineering to align data insights with business objectives. A common challenge is translating complex data findings into actionable recommendations for non-technical stakeholders. Additionally, balancing multiple priorities and managing expectations across teams can require strong communication and project management skills. Proactively building relationships and maintaining open lines of communication can help overcome these challenges and ensure successful collaboration.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ior data analyst,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Data Analyst, you need advanced analytical skills, a strong foundation in statistics, and experience with data modeling, typically supported by a relevant degree in mathematics, statistics, or computer science. Expertise in data visualization tools (like Tableau or Power BI), SQL, and programming languages such as Python or R is often required, along with familiarity with big data platforms. Outstanding problem-solving, communication, and stakeholder management skills set top performers apart. These competencies ensure accurate data-driven insights and effective collaboration with business teams to drive strategic decision-making.

Overview 
 
As a Senior Data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in driving our data strategy and standard methodologies for data collection, pipelines, usage, and infrastructure. We are looking for someone with a deep sense of curiosity and an affinity for building innovative products based on data.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to communicate data constellations and tools, leveraging your skills in reverse engineering, analytics, and creative problem-solving to devise data and BI solutions.
 
 
Responsibilities
  • Work with large volumes of traffic data and user behaviors to develop pipelines that enhance raw data quality.
  • Break down complex data problems and communicate feasible solutions proficiently.
  • Extract patterns from large datasets and transform data into actionable insights.
  • Utilize tools such as Jupyter, SQL, dashboards, statistical analysis, and data visualizations to explore datasets and find answers to business questions.
  • Partner with internal product and business intelligence teams to identify optimal data ingestion, structure, and storage approaches.
  • Collaborate with technology field partners to ensure reliable implementation of data solutions.
  • Provide innovative ideas to improve data and collaborate with engineering, BI teams, and business units to implement changes.
  • Lead projects from inception to completion, ensuring successful implementation of data solutions.
  • Contribute to advancing the team in technology and best practices
  • Mentor junior team members on best practices and approaches around data.
Basic Qualifications
  • STEM undergraduate degree with 4+ years of work experience or STEM graduate degree with 2+ years of post-graduation work experience in Analytics/Measurement/Data Operations fields or consulting roles focusing on digital analytics implementations.
  • Knowledge with relational and NoSQL data management systems (e.g., BigTable, HBase, Cassandra, MongoDB).
  • Proficiency in Python and SQL.
  • Experience with exploratory data analysis using tools like iPython Notebook, Pandas, and matplotlib.
  • Demonstrated development of ongoing technical solutions while maintaining documentation and training impacted teams.
  • Experience developing solutions to business requirements through hands-on discovery and exploration of data.
  • Robust written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to translate technical concepts for non-technical audiences and vice versa.
  • Experience building and deploying applications on a cloud platform (preferably Google Cloud Platform).
  • Ability to influence and apply data standards, policies, and procedures.
Bonus Skills 
  • Experience with marketing tools such as Kochava, Braze, Branch, and Salesforce Marketing Cloud.
  • Knowledge with Apache Airflow.
  • Knowledge of data modeling.
  • Knowledge with GIT.
  • Proficiency in statistical analyses using tools such as R, Numpy/SciPy with Python.
  • Experience with Adobe Analytics (Omniture) or Google Analytics.
  • Knowledge of digital marketing strategies including site, video, social media, SEM, SEO, and display advertising.
  • Knowledge with ELT/ETL concepts.
  • Knowledge of AI frameworks and prior implementation experience is a plus.
